Godalming High Street has not kept the grace of Guildford,nor had it ever the width and the air of Epsom or Farnham,but it has more than one building of distinction, and its linkswith the past are in old inns, timbered stories and forgottencourts. The White Hart still juts its wooden beams over thepavement; the Kings Arms, a later building, has a square-setfront which has watched many coaches jangle off to Portsmouth.The Kings Arms has had more than one king as a guest.The Emperor Alexander I of Russia and King Frederick William of Pr
